news 2026/2/8 2:47:10

终极ComfyUI-Crystools实战指南:从安装到精通的AI图像工作流增强工具

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
终极ComfyUI-Crystools实战指南:从安装到精通的AI图像工作流增强工具

终极ComfyUI-Crystools实战指南:从安装到精通的AI图像工作流增强工具

【免费下载链接】ComfyUI-CrystoolsA powerful set of tools for ComfyUI项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Crystools

ComfyUI-Crystools是一套功能强大的ComfyUI插件集合,专为AI图像生成工作流提供全面的实用工具和增强功能。本指南将带你从环境准备到高级应用,全方位掌握这个能显著提升工作效率和创作体验的工具集。

准备篇:如何搭建ComfyUI-Crystools开发环境

系统环境检查清单

在开始安装前,请确保你的系统满足以下要求:

  • Python 3.8 或更高版本
  • 已安装ComfyUI主程序
  • Node.js环境(用于前端构建)

三步完成基础安装

  1. 克隆项目仓库进入ComfyUI自定义节点目录,执行以下命令:

    cd ComfyUI/custom_nodes git clone https://gitcode.com/gh_mirrors/co/ComfyUI-Crystools
  2. 安装Python依赖包

    cd ComfyUI-Crystools pip install -r requirements.txt
  3. 构建前端资源(可选)如果你需要修改前端界面,可以运行:

    npm install npm run build

⚠️注意事项:安装完成后,必须重启ComfyUI服务才能使新节点生效。如果节点未显示,请检查依赖是否安装完整或项目是否放置在正确的custom_nodes目录下。

核心配置文件解析

文件名主要作用配置要点
pyproject.toml项目构建配置定义包信息和依赖关系
requirements.txtPython依赖管理包含所有必要的Python库
package.json前端配置管理前端依赖和构建脚本
core/config.py核心配置可自定义工具行为的关键参数

入门篇:Crystools基础功能快速上手

如何添加并使用图像预览节点

图像预览节点是Crystools最常用的功能之一,它能实时显示生成结果和详细元数据。

  1. 在ComfyUI节点菜单中找到"Crystools"分类
  2. 将"Image Preview"节点拖入工作区
  3. 连接图像输出端到该节点
  4. 点击运行后即可在界面上查看图像和元数据

数据调试技巧:JSON格式可视化方法

调试器节点能帮助你实时监控工作流中的数据流,特别适合复杂工作流的问题定位。

使用步骤:

  1. 选择"Show any to JSON"节点
  2. 连接需要监控的数据端口
  3. 启用"display"选项
  4. 运行工作流后查看格式化的JSON数据

系统资源监控面板设置步骤

监控面板提供系统资源使用情况的实时视图,帮助你优化资源分配。

设置流程:

  1. 添加"Monitor"节点到工作流
  2. 配置需要监控的资源类型(CPU、GPU、内存等)
  3. 调整更新频率参数
  4. 运行工作流查看实时监控数据

进阶篇:高效工作流构建技巧

管道节点串联多步骤数据处理方法

管道系统允许你创建复杂的数据处理流程,将多个操作串联实现自动化工作流。

使用技巧:

  • 使用"Pipe left/edit any"节点作为流程起点
  • 通过"Pipe any"节点串联多个处理步骤
  • 合理规划数据流向,减少不必要的节点连接
  • 利用管道参数传递上下文信息

元数据对比分析:参数优化实战

元数据比较器节点让你能够深入分析不同生成结果的参数差异,优化创作效果。

操作步骤:

  1. 添加两个"Load image with metadata"节点
  2. 分别加载需要比较的图像
  3. 添加"Metadata comparator"节点
  4. 连接两个图像节点的元数据输出
  5. 选择需要比较的参数类别(如prompt、seed等)

进度条组件集成与自定义

进度条组件能直观展示处理状态,提升用户体验。

集成方法:

// 在自定义节点中添加进度条 const progressBar = new CrystoolsProgressBar({ container: this.widgets.find(w => w.name === "progress_container"), color: "#4CAF50", height: "8px" }); // 更新进度 progressBar.update(progress);

精通篇:高级功能与效率优化

常见错误排查流程图解

当遇到问题时,可按照以下流程进行排查:

  1. 节点未显示

    • 检查ComfyUI是否已重启
    • 验证依赖是否安装完整
    • 确认项目路径是否正确
  2. 图像预览不工作

    • 检查节点连接是否正确
    • 查看浏览器控制台错误信息
    • 验证图像路径权限
  3. 性能监控数据异常

    • 检查系统权限设置
    • 验证硬件监控接口是否可用
    • 尝试重启ComfyUI服务

效率提升快捷键清单

掌握以下快捷键能显著提升操作速度:

快捷键功能描述
Ctrl+Shift+P打开命令面板
Alt+Click快速复制节点
Ctrl+D复制选中节点
Ctrl+G组合节点
Shift+拖动框选多个节点
Ctrl+Z撤销操作

功能模块对比选择指南

根据不同使用场景选择合适的功能模块:

使用场景推荐节点组合优势
快速原型设计Image Preview + Debugger实时反馈,便于调整参数
批量图像处理List节点 + Pipe系统高效处理多个图像
参数优化Metadata Comparator + Debugger精确对比不同参数效果
资源监控Monitor节点 + Progress Bar实时掌握系统状态

总结

通过本指南,你已经了解了ComfyUI-Crystools的安装配置、基础使用和高级技巧。从简单的图像预览到复杂的管道系统,这些工具能够极大地提升你的AI图像创作效率。建议从基础功能开始实践,逐步尝试更复杂的工作流构建,充分发挥这个强大工具集的潜力。

如需进一步探索,可以查阅项目中的示例文件(位于samples/目录),这些示例展示了各种典型使用场景,能够帮助你更快掌握高级功能。

【免费下载链接】ComfyUI-CrystoolsA powerful set of tools for ComfyUI项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-Crystools

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/2/6 21:43:03

高效Windows资源编辑:rcedit工具全方位应用指南

高效Windows资源编辑:rcedit工具全方位应用指南 【免费下载链接】rcedit Command line tool to edit resources of exe 项目地址: https://gitcode.com/gh_mirrors/rc/rcedit 在Windows应用开发中,可执行文件修改是一项常见需求,无论是…

作者头像 李华
网站建设 2026/2/4 10:58:56

人人都能做微调:低秩适应技术落地实践全揭秘

人人都能做微调:低秩适应技术落地实践全揭秘 在大模型应用的日常实践中,很多人误以为“微调”是工程师专属的高门槛操作——需要写复杂训练脚本、调参、配环境、等数小时显存爆炸式报错。但现实早已不同:单张消费级显卡、十分钟、无需代码基…

作者头像 李华
网站建设 2026/2/7 10:00:20

Qwen3-VL-8B Web系统惊艳效果展示:复杂图表识别+数据趋势分析对话

Qwen3-VL-8B Web系统惊艳效果展示:复杂图表识别数据趋势分析对话 1. 系统效果概览 Qwen3-VL-8B AI聊天系统展现了令人印象深刻的多模态理解能力,特别是在复杂图表识别和数据趋势分析方面。这个基于通义千问大模型的Web应用,不仅能理解用户上…

作者头像 李华
网站建设 2026/2/6 21:46:53

YOLOv9镜像避坑指南,新手常见问题全解析

YOLOv9镜像避坑指南,新手常见问题全解析 YOLOv9刚发布时,很多开发者兴奋地冲去部署,结果在环境激活、路径配置、权重加载、CUDA兼容性上接连踩坑——明明是“开箱即用”的镜像,怎么一打开就报错?训练跑不起来&#xf…

作者头像 李华
网站建设 2026/2/6 5:56:03

Chandra显存优化部署:低配设备运行gemma:2b的GPU利用率提升方案

Chandra显存优化部署:低配设备运行gemma:2b的GPU利用率提升方案 1. 引言 在本地部署大语言模型时,显存资源往往是最大的瓶颈。特别是对于只有4GB或8GB显存的低配GPU设备,如何高效运行像gemma:2b这样的轻量级模型,成为许多开发者…

作者头像 李华
网站建设 2026/2/7 4:56:31

解决Mac安卓USB网络共享难题:HoRNDIS工具实战指南

解决Mac安卓USB网络共享难题:HoRNDIS工具实战指南 【免费下载链接】HoRNDIS Android USB tethering driver for Mac OS X 项目地址: https://gitcode.com/gh_mirrors/ho/HoRNDIS 在移动办公与开发场景中,Mac用户常常面临安卓设备网络共享的兼容性…

作者头像 李华